Analysis of theoretical return to player in online casino games

Online casino games have become increasingly popular in recent years, with millions of players around the world enjoying the thrill of gambling from the comfort of their own homes. One of the key factors that players consider when choosing which online casino games to play is the theoretical return to player (RTP) percentage.
The theoretical return to player is a mathematical calculation that represents the average amount of money that a player can expect to win back from a particular casino game over time. It is important for players to understand the RTP of a game, as it can have a significant impact on their chances of winning and their overall experience.
There are several factors that can affect the theoretical return to player in online casino games. One of the most important factors is the house edge, which is the advantage that the casino has over the player. The house edge is built into the game’s design and is calculated based on the rules and odds of the game. Games with a higher house edge here will have a lower theoretical return to player, while games with a lower house edge will have a higher theoretical return to player.
Another factor that can affect the theoretical return to player is the volatility of the game. Volatility refers to the frequency and size of wins in a game. Games with high volatility will have fewer but larger wins, while games with low volatility will have more frequent but smaller wins.
